One of the most common problems that can occur with uPVC windows is that they become difficult to open or lock. This issue usually occurs when the locking mechanism is stiff or sluggish. It is possible to lubricate the lock and handle using graphite or machine oil. This will let the mechanism free up and the window or door to function normal again.

Another issue that is often encountered with uPVC windows is that the hinges get stiff or even stuck. This problem is usually caused by grit and dust that build up on the hinges. The solution is to lubricate the hinges using oil or grease. The wrong oil, however, could lead to damage and may make the hinges unusable.

On average, the cost for fixing broken or cracked stained glass is around $500. The exact price will depend on the type of solution required to fix the issue. A professional might use epoxy edge-gluing or copper foil to repair the broken glass. They can also relead lead cames and repair stained glass. Several options are available, and each has advantages and disadvantages. The best solution depends on the size, location and the type of glass being used.

Cracks in leaded glass can be caused by thermal expansion and contraction, building movement or just normal wear and tear. Over time, cracks could develop and cause more issues. To avoid further damage and growth the crack that runs across an important part of a stained-glass panel or the face must be fixed as fast as possible. In the past, this was accomplished by cutting a "Dutchman's" lead flange on top of the crack. This method was not a great solution, and today there are better ways to repair these types of cracks.

Stained glass restoration can take on various varieties. It can be as simple as repairing cracks, or as complicated as restoring a whole stained glass window or door panel to its original form. In general, the cost for a complete restoration is much higher than the cost of a simple repair. The project involves cleaning and taking out damaged glass, tightening lead cames, sealing the cement and re-tying it, and replacing stained glass pieces that are missing.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ping prevents water and air from entering homes through the gaps around doors and windows. It is an important aspect of home maintenance that could help you save money on energy bills and costly repairs. It can also make a home more comfortable. The materials used to create this seal will degrade with time, Upvc Repairs due to wear and tear. It is essential to replace these materials periodically.

You can tell the weather stripping is been damaged by noticing a spot that is wet after washing the windows, a whistling sound when driving down the road, or a draft that you can feel when you are in front of a closed-door. These are all signs that it's time for an expert in repair for weatherstripping near me.

Taskers can use various weatherstripping materials to seal your doors and windows. Foam tapes are composed of open-cell or closed cell foam. They come in different sizes, thicknesses, and widths. They are simple to install and cut by cutting. Felt strips are also affordable and last for a year or two. You can cut them to size with scissors, and attach them to the frame of your door, hinge side, or sliding windows with staples, glue, or tacks. Vinyl or metal V-strips are a little more complicated to put in place however they can be nailed into the window jamb.
